Effects of sleep deprivation:
Lower stress threshold: Normal tasks may seem overwhelming Impaired memory: REM sleep aids in memory formation, lack of it will impair your memory. Trouble concentrating: If you are tired all day, it will be harder to concentrate on daily tasks. Decreased optimism: You often feel more irritable, and less hopeful. Increased food consumption: Sleep loss enhances pleasure response processing in the brain making you want to consume food. Increased risk of cardiac morbidity: Lack of sleep induces inflammation. |
Benefits to sleep:
Improves memory: During sleep you strengthen your memories. Live longer: Too little and too much sleep is correlated with a shorter life span. Sharpen attention: If you are well rested you are more alert. Maintain a healthy weight: Research shows if you get more rest, you tend to lose more weight. Lower stress: Getting more sleep allows you to have lower blood pressure, which is correlated with lower stress. Avoid accidents: Sleepiness increases your chance for an accident. |
